AI governance
SpEd Coach uses AI to reduce repetitive drafting work, not to make educational, eligibility, placement, or legal decisions.
AI assistance produces drafts and summaries. A qualified team member reviews, edits, and approves before anything is finalized.
Administrators choose which AI features are enabled, for which roles, and in which modules. Off is a first-class state.
AI activity is logged so leadership can see where it is used, by whom, and on what kind of work.
Data protection
Every workflow that touches documents follows the same protected path. No AI step runs on raw, un-reviewed sensitive content.
Secure Upload
Encrypted in transit and at rest
Extraction
Structured document parsing
PII Detection
Identify sensitive fields
Redaction
Mask before downstream use
AI Assistance
Drafts and summaries only
Human Review
Required before finalization
Access to documents and pipeline activity is scoped by role and logged for administrator review.
